The patient currently drinks 4 12 oz. cans of diet soda per day. How many ounces of diet soda can the patient drink if he reduces his intake by 25%?

  1. 12 ounces
  2. 24 ounces
  3. 36 ounces
  4. 40 ounces

Answer(s): C

Explanation:

Patient currently consumes 48 ounces (4 × 12 oz.). Patient has to give up 25% of 48 ounces = 48 × 0.25 = 12 oz. Therefore, the patient can drink 48 − 12 = 36 ounces.

Solve this ratio and proportion problem:
0.7 is to 10 as N is to 100. What is N?

  1. 0.7
  2. 7
  3. 70
  4. 700

Answer(s): B

Explanation:

Solve as a fraction: 0.7/10 = N/100 => 0.7×100 = N×10 => N=0.7×100/10 = 0.7×10 = 7.
